As these systems mature, a common question arises: what happens to your photovoltaic (PV) system after three decades of service? Many people believe solar panels simply stop working, but the reality is more nuanced. In fact, most continue generating electricity for many years beyond their warranty period. After a quarter-century of service, typical photovoltaic cells still operate at 80-90% of their original capacity, maintaining impressive efficiency. .

Monocrystalline PV module prices in Kenya
Monocrystalline solar panel price in Kenya depends on brand, size, and wattage. Prices range from KES 6,000 to KES 20,000 for most panels. Brands like Jinko, Canadian Solar, Longi, and Trina are common in. . The Prices of Solar Panels in Kenya range from as low as KSh 2,500 for a basic 50W panel to over KSh 30,000 for high-capacity 550W panels, with complete home solar systems costing between KSh 200,000 to KSh 900,000, depending on your energy needs.
